A rare opportunity to purchase this beautifully presented four-bedroom semi-detached family home, ideally positioned in one of Horwich’s most sought-after locations at the top of Brownlow Road, on the doorstep of the stunning Rivington countryside.
Fully renovated and thoughtfully reconfigured by the current owners, the property offers spacious, versatile accommodation with a bright and modern finish throughout, allowing any buyer to move straight in and simply add their own personal touch. Recent improvements include a newly fitted kitchen, bathroom & wc, landscaped rear garden, and a superb loft conversion, creating flexible living space rarely found in homes of this type.
The accommodation extends to four generous double bedrooms, including the impressive loft conversion which has been fully completed to building regulations, along with four reception rooms and three bathrooms, making it an ideal long-term family home.
The ground floor comprises a welcoming entrance hallway with newly installed understairs WC, a spacious front lounge with bay window and feature fireplace, and a stunning open-plan kitchen fitted with a modern range of wall and base units. To the rear, the kitchen flows into the dining and sitting area, complete with log burner and direct access to the garden, creating the perfect family and entertaining space.
To the first floor, a traditional staircase leads to a spacious landing serving three well-proportioned double bedrooms, all complemented by a newly installed modern three-piece tiled bathroom suite. The landing has been cleverly reconfigured to accommodate a staircase to the second-floor loft conversion, which provides an excellent principal or guest bedroom with dressing area and Velux windows enjoying views towards Rivington.
Externally, the property continues to impress. A generous driveway provides off-road parking for multiple vehicles, while the integral garage benefits from power, lighting, water supply, overhead storage, and rear access.
The standout feature is the expansive landscaped rear garden, larger than most in the area, offering a lawn, multiple patio seating areas, and a hot tub beneath a pergola. The garden enjoys sunshine well into the evening and is perfectly suited for entertaining or family living.
Situated in a quiet semi-rural setting, the home is within easy reach of local pubs and restaurants, Horwich town centre, Middlebrook Retail Park, and excellent transport links including the M61 motorway and nearby train stations. Highly regarded schools including Bolton School, Rivington & Blackrod High School, and Blackrod Primary School are all close by, offering the very best of both town and countryside living.
